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ink
Am I evergreen?
Yes, the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ink is an evergreen plant that retains its leaves throughout the year. This makes the plant a beautiful addition to the garden, even during the winter months.
How many degrees of winter hardiness am I?
The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ink is hardy up to about -5 degrees Celsius. It is recommended to protect the plant well in winter, for example by applying mulch or straw around the roots. In harsh winters, it may be necessary to protect the plant with fleece, for example.
Am I easy to maintain?
Yes, the Alstrome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ink is easy to maintain and requires little special care. As long as the plant receives enough water and light, it will grow and blossom healthily. It is a strong and winter-hardy garden plant that will give few problems.
How much space do I need?
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ink needs about 30-40 cm of space to grow and spread. Make sure the plant has enough room to develop and bloom. It is recommended to plant the plant in a sunny location with well-draining soil.
Do I grow well in the shade?
The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ink grows best in full sun or partial shade. In the shade, the growth of the plant may be hindered and the bloom will be less abundant. Make sure to provide enough light for the plant to grow optimally.
How many times a week do I need water?
The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ink requires regular watering, especially during dry periods. It is recommended to keep the soil lightly moist and prevent the roots from drying out. Generally, the plant needs water once a week, but this may vary depending on environmental conditions.

In which months do I bloom and for how long?
The Alstroemeria Inticancha Creamy Dark Pink blooms from June to September. The flowering period lasts for about 3 to 4 months.
Can I tolerate full sun?
This plant can tolerate full sun. It is important to keep the soil well moist during hot days. Provide sufficient water and ensure good drainage.
